FAQ: What if QuotaGrove locks out a tenant entirely?

Good question — yes, it happens. QuotaGrove enforces per-tenant rate quotas, and a misconfigured multiplier can drop a tenant's allowance to zero, blocking even their admin traffic. For security reviewers: the override path is audited and requires two-person sign-off, so don't worry about silent abuse. To lift the lockout, open the quota override console and enter the recovery passphrase below.

unlock words, hahip-baduf: holwyn-istath-julvan

Quick heads-up before you approve: the FareForge rules engine for shipping fees ships as v4.2 tonight. We flattened the zone-surcharge rules into a single decision table, so diff carefully around the Brindlemoor carrier overrides. Smoke tests pass on staging. Once you're happy, the build gets signed before promotion. The key we'll sign the release artifact with is below.

rollout seal: bky4_x7Gc

## Snapshot Testing API

The Glimmerkit render service captures deterministic snapshots of UI components for regression comparison. As a new contractor, submit a component bundle to the `/snapshots` endpoint; the service renders it headlessly, hashes the output, and diffs against the stored baseline. Mismatches return an annotated image pair. All snapshot requests must be authenticated with the token below.

login token, bagug-kafop: eyJhbGciOiJIUzI1NiIsInR5cCI6IkpXVCJ9.eyJzdWIiOiIcMLov2In0.Z5RLDIfp

## Liftgrid Simulator — Restart

The dispatch simulator replays car-call traces against the Liftgrid scheduler. If runs stall, kill the replay process, clear the scratch queue, and restart. Do not touch the trace files; they are checksummed at load. The simulator reads all tuning parameters from its environment at launch, and the values currently in use are as follows.

deployment values, kahof-yadug:
[gorys]
team = silael
access_code = ac_00d620
owner = istox.oliys
host = gorys.torvastack.example
port = 9000
peer = holmir.merlaqsoft.example
salt = 9fdae78a
pin = 2358